2.软文推荐
3.软文推荐
如果你想打造一款出色的jQuery应用程序或者网站,那么掌握事件绑定的技巧是非常重要的。但是,如果你刚刚开始学习jQuery,这可能会让你感到非常困惑。本文将提供一些非常实用的技巧,以帮助你更轻松地掌握jQuery事件绑定。
## 什么是事件绑定?
在深入探讨jQuery事件绑定技巧之前,让我们先了解一下事件绑定到底是什么。事件绑定是指将JavaScript事件处理程序附加到特定的HTML元素上,以便在事件发生时执行一些代码。例如,当用户单击一个按钮时,你可能希望显示一条消息或者执行某些其他操作。
## 何时使用事件绑定?
现在你已经了解了事件绑定的含义,让我们来看看何时应该使用它。当你需要用户与某个元素进行交互时,事件绑定就会派上用场。例如,你可能希望在用户单击某个按钮或者拖动某个元素时执行一些代码。通过使用事件绑定技术,你可以轻松地实现这一点。
## jQuery事件绑定技巧
下面是一些jQuery事件绑定技巧,可以帮助你更轻松地掌握这一技术:
### 1.使用on()方法
on()方法是jQuery事件绑定中最重要的方法之一。它可以将事件处理程序附加到元素上,并且可以绑定多个事件。例如,你可以通过以下代码来将单击和双击事件绑定到某个元素上:
``` $("#myelement").on("click dblclick", function(){ //执行某些代码 }); ```
### 2.使用off()方法
off()方法可以用于删除先前绑定的事件处理程序。例如,下面的代码可以将所有单击事件处理程序从myelement元素中删除:
``` $("#myelement").off("click"); ```
### 3.使用one()方法
one()方法只能够绑定一次事件。例如,你可以使用以下代码来仅仅将单击事件绑定到某个元素上一次:
``` $("#myelement").one("click", function(){ //执行某些代码 }); ```
### 4.使用delegate()方法
delegate()方法可以将事件处理程序附加到以后动态添加到文档中的元素。例如,你可以将单击事件处理程序附加到所有动态添加的myelement元素上:
``` $(document).delegate("#myelement", "click", function(){ //执行某些代码 }); ```
### 5.使用live()方法
live()方法可以将事件处理程序附加到当前和将来的匹配元素。例如,以下代码将单击事件处理程序附加到所有带有myelement类的元素:
``` $(".myelement").live("click", function(){ //执行某些代码 }); ```
## 总结
事件绑定是一项非常重要的技术,可以让你创建出色的jQuery应用程序。通过使用on()、off()、one()、delegate()和live()等方法,你可以轻松地通过JavaScript操作HTML元素。现在,你已经了解了一些jQuery事件绑定技巧,希望你可以在实践中快速掌握这一技术。
1
CentOS 7视频转码":高效处理海量视频数据的利器 摘要:视频转码是处理海量视频数据的一项重要工作,CentOS 7作为一款流行的开源操作系统...